  • Earl of Carnarvon, a title created more than once
    • Robert Dormer, 1st Earl of Carnarvon (1610-1643)
    • Charles Dormer, 2nd Earl of Carnarvon (1632-1709)
    • Henry Herbert, 1st Earl of Carnarvon (1741-1811)
    • Henry Herbert, 2nd Earl of Carnarvon (1772-1833)
    • Henry Herbert, 3rd Earl of Carnarvon (1800-1849)
    • Henry Herbert, 4th Earl of Carnarvon (1831-1890)
    • George Herbert, 5th Earl of Carnarvon (1866-1923), financed the excavations which discovered Tutankhamun's tomb
    • Henry Herbert, 6th Earl of Carnarvon (1898-1987)
    • Henry Herbert, 7th Earl of Carnarvon (1924-2001)
    • George Herbert, 8th Earl of Carnarvon (born 1956)
